Add 35/10 and 90/14
1st number: 3 5/10, 2nd number: 6 6/14
35/10 + 90/14 is 139/14.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 10 and 14 is 70
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 70 - For the 1st fraction, since 10 × 7 = 70,
35/10 = 35 × 7/10 × 7 = 245/70 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 14 × 5 = 70,
90/14 = 90 × 5/14 × 5 = 450/70 - Add the two like fractions:
245/70 + 450/70 = 245 + 450/70 = 695/70 - 695/70 simplified gives 139/14
- So, 35/10 + 90/14 = 139/14
